VeEX announces new WX150 WiFi Air Expert test set
May 14, 2018
VeEX, a global player in Telecom, CATV, Fibre, Transport and Broadband Access, has announced the launch of its WX150 WiFi Air Expert test set.
Building on the success of its MTTplus-900 module for the MTTplus platform, VeEX’s WX150 provides the same powerful WiFi test functionalities as the MTTplus-900 module, all in a compact, standalone test set form factor.
Lightweight and easy to carry, with up to 8 hours of continuous operation on a full battery charge, the WX150 is the perfect tool for a comprehensive site survey. The WX150 supports wireless standards 802.11 a, b, g, n, ac and 3×3:3 MIMO channels. Featuring both WiFi and wired Ethernet interfaces as well as a dedicated spectrum analyzer, the Air Expert test set removes the need to carry around various specialised pieces of test equipment. It covers all aspects of the installation and maintenance processes, from RF network discovery, passive and active site survey, to troubleshooting and traffic load performance testing.
The WX150, along with the WiFi Air Expert series of products, will be on display at the WI-FI NOW conference May 15-17 in Redwood City, CA.
